Neighborhood Overview
Emblaze Academy is situated in the Hunts Point section of the Bronx, a vibrant area characterized by its industrial history and evolving community landscape. Visitors typically arrive via the Bruckner Expressway, which provides the primary access route for those traveling by car from other boroughs or the suburbs. Parking in the immediate vicinity is primarily street-based, so arriving early is highly recommended to secure a spot within a reasonable walking distance. The nearest major airport is LaGuardia (LGA), which is generally a 20-to-30-minute drive depending on typical city traffic patterns.
For those utilizing public transit, the area is served by local bus lines and nearby subway stations that connect to the broader New York City network. Rideshare services are a reliable way to reach the school, especially during peak school hours when local street parking becomes more limited. We suggest planning your arrival to account for potential congestion near school zones, particularly during morning drop-offs or afternoon dismissals. Utilizing navigation apps in real-time is the best strategy for adjusting to sudden road work or bridge traffic. Staying aware of local parking signage is essential to avoid unnecessary tickets while visiting the neighborhood.

Weather & Seasons
Winter
Winters in the Bronx are cold and often windy, with occasional snowfalls that can impact travel. Visitors should pack heavy coats, scarves, and gloves to stay comfortable during transit. Ensure your footwear is suitable for potentially wet or icy sidewalks.
Spring & early summer
This is a beautiful time to visit, with temperatures warming up and the neighborhood parks coming to life. It is perfect for walking between the school and nearby attractions. Pack light layers as the weather can shift from cool mornings to warm afternoons.
Mid-summer
Summer months bring heat and humidity to the city, making mid-day hours quite intense for outdoor activities. Stay hydrated and plan your schedule to take advantage of air-conditioned indoor spaces. Lightweight, breathable clothing is highly recommended for all visitors during this period.
Fall season
Autumn provides some of the best weather for visiting, with crisp air and comfortable temperatures for exploring the area. It is a popular time for events, so expect moderate crowds around the city. A light jacket is usually sufficient for most outdoor activities during this season.
Rain & snow
Rain can occur throughout the year, so carrying a compact umbrella is a smart move for any traveler. Snow is primarily a winter concern that may occasionally slow down traffic and public transit. Always check local forecasts before heading out to ensure you have the appropriate gear.
